Compare all specifications:
2007 Hyundai Elantra | 2000 Opel Astra | |
Make | Hyundai | Opel |
Model | Elantra | Astra |
Year Released | 2007 | 2000 |
Body Type | Sedan | Coupe |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1999 cc | 2196 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 138 HP | 145 HP |
Engine RPM | 6000 RPM | 5800 RPM |
Torque | 184 Nm | 203 Nm |
Torque RPM | 4600 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 82 mm | 86 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 93.5 mm | 94.6 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 10.0:1 | 10.0:1 |
Acceleration 0-100mph | 9.1 seconds | 10 seconds |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1450 kg | 1328 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4510 mm | 4270 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1780 mm | 1720 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1490 mm | 1400 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2660 mm | 2640 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 45 L | 53 L |
